The centerpiece visit is the 23-point annual tune-up: every wear surface on the door — springs, cables, drums, rollers, hinges, bearing plates, tracks, brackets, opener gear and drive — checked and lubricated, plus the safety systems verified with a photo-eye and auto-reverse test. When you need formal documentation rather than just service, we also perform written safety inspections for home sales, insurance audits, rental-property compliance, and post-incident review: a signed, photographed report covering UL-325 compliance, spring and cable health, and structural integrity, emailed as a PDF within hours of the visit.
Maintenance also covers the comfort side of a garage door. We replace bottom astragal seals (T-style, P-style, and bulb profiles), jamb and header weatherstripping, and threshold kits to keep drafts, water, dust, and pests out. Balance adjustment re-tensions the springs so the door holds at half-open without drifting — out-of-balance doors are the #1 cause of premature opener failure we see. And for doors that wake the household, our noise-reduction package combines sealed-bearing nylon rollers, anti-rattle hinge bushings, vibration isolators, and full lubrication for a measured 12–18 dB drop in operating noise. How to tell you need garage door maintenance
No service in 12+ months
Most components benefit from annual lubrication and inspection. Going past 18 months without service moves you into reactive-repair territory.
Heavy daily use
Households with 3+ daily cycles or commercial doors with 10+ daily cycles benefit from semi-annual rather than annual service.
Coastal location
Coastal zones see corrosion progress faster. Semi-annual service is the right cadence.
Aging opener (8+ years)
Older openers benefit disproportionately from regular service — a tune-up that lubricates the rail and inspects the gears can add 2–3 years to a 10-year-old opener.
Pre-listing prep
A documented maintenance history adds confidence in inspection negotiations during home sale.
Door is noticeably louder than last year
Increasing noise is the earliest sign of bearing, roller, or hinge wear. Lubrication and adjustment at this stage prevents the underlying components from failing.
Door slams down or drifts when stopped halfway
The classic balance test — disconnect the opener, lift the door to half, release. Drift down means under-tension; drift up means over-tension. Either way the opener is working harder than designed.
Visible gap under the closed door
A pencil-width gap or larger means the bottom seal is worn, cracked, or compressed — letting in water, dust, and pests. Seal replacement restores the tight close.
The failures we fix, and what causes them in Caddo Mills
Lubrication degradation
Factory grease dries out in 12–18 months. Re-lubrication is the single highest-leverage maintenance task.
UV degradation of seals
Vinyl and rubber weatherstripping hardens and cracks under years of sun exposure. Hardened seals tear at the floor contact line and stop sealing.
Spring fatigue and cable stretch
Springs lose 5–10% of tension over their cycle life and cables elongate slightly under load. Both shift the door out of balance — the #1 cause of premature opener failure we see.
Worn rollers and rigid opener mounting
Plain steel rollers wear flats and noisy bearings, and openers bolted directly to ceiling joists transfer vibration into the house. Both are fixable during a scheduled visit.
Sensor drift
Photo-eye sensors shift slightly with temperature cycling. Realignment keeps the safety system in spec.
Corrosion
Surface corrosion on springs, cables, and hardware progresses inward over time. Maintenance treatment with corrosion-inhibiting lubricants slows it dramatically.
Component wear
Every moving part on a garage door wears continuously. Maintenance slows the rate of wear and catches end-of-life on a planned schedule.
Fastener loosening
Vibration backs off bracket and track screws over thousands of cycles. Re-torque keeps the door tracking straight.
